Wizz Air Holdings Plc.’s shares are now available on BSE’s “BETa Market”, an alternative platform of the Budapest Stock Exchange. The BETa platform offers the opportunity to trade securities of large European companies. As a result, the shares of the international airline, which has Hungarian origins, can be accessed without currency conversion through investment providers. Settlement is in HUF, and OTP Bank will act as market maker.
